Spartan Men Struggle in Loss at Northland
The M State Men’s basketball team struggled from the get-go on Monday night in Thief River Falls, falling behind 31-13 at the half and losing to the Pioneers by a final score of 59-42. The Spartans shot just 31.5% (17-54) on the night and finished without a scorer in double figures.

James Hamilton (8 points, 7 rebounds), Drew Overby (8 points), Mach Mayen (7 points), Carter Clark (6 points, 3 rebounds) and Braylon Baldwin (4 points, 5 rebounds, 3 assists) were the statistical leaders for M State.
Northland led the rebounding battle, 41-31, and shot 42.4% (25-59) from the field. They were led by Alex Loomis (22 points, 7 rebounds), Randell Charlin (10 points, 9 rebunds, 7 assists) and Esron Simeon (6 points, 10 rebounds, 6 assists, 2 steals). Deng Kuek added 7 points, 4 boards and 3 steals, while Kmar Honore came off the bench to score 8 points.
M State (11-6 overall, 1-3 MCAC South) will host Ridgewater on Wednesday night in Fergus Falls.
